Festival EcardsFestivals are special occasions that most people celebrate. You can send your best wishes to your loved ones with the help of specially designed Festival Ecards. Cherish the beauty of these special occasions with these ecards. #Festival Ecards#Electronic Greeting Cards Online#Flora and Fauna Ecards#Greeting Cards Malaysia Online#Malaysia Ecards#Special Birthday Ecards Malaysia#Virtual Greeting Cards Malaysia·feeds.feedburner.com·Sep 23, 2025Festival Ecards